The Texas Department of Agriculture (the department) and the Texas Agricultural
Finance Authority propose to review Title 4, Texas Administrative Code, Part
1, Chapter 24, concerning the Farm and Ranch Finance Program, Chapter 26,
concerning the Linked Deposit Program, Chapter 28, concerning the Financial
Assistance Program, and Chapter 30, concerning the Young Farmer Loan Guarantee
Program, pursuant to the Texas Government Code, §2001.039. Section 2001.039
requires state agencies to review and consider for readoption each of their
rules every four years. The review must include an assessment of whether the
original justification for the rules continues to exist.
The assessment of Title 4, Part 1, Chapters 24, 26, 28 and 30 by the department
at this time indicates that the reason for readopting without changes all
sections in Chapters 24, 26, 28 and 30 continues to exist.

The Texas State Library and Archives Commission proposes to review its
rules in 13 TAC Chapter 1 concerning library development pursuant to the requirements
of the Government Code, §2001.039.
The rules were adopted pursuant to the Government Code §441.136 that
requires the Texas State Library and Archives Commission to adopt rules regarding
the administration of the program of state grants, including qualifications
for major resource system membership. The rules are necessary to carry out
the statutory obligations of the Texas State Library and Archives Commission
administer grant programs, including the Texas Library Systems.
